- See the local sights such as Valentines mine, Split
rock, Bald Hill, Hawkins Hill (where Beyers and Holterman found the largest
gold specimen in the world weighing 286 Kilograms).
- Wander the town and read the signs displayed giving
details of what shops etc that existed on the spot and showing the photo’s
taken in the 1870’s by Beaufoy Merlin showing buildings that have disappeared
over the years.
- Visit the local rivers.
- Hill End is a lovely place to explore with its rich
orange soil and interesting landscape. A great example of this is The Arch.
Hill End’s landscape is popular among artists such as Russell Drysdale and
Donald friend.

- Relax, unwind, enjoy the peace and quiet. Relive the
life of days long gone staying in an authentic 1870’s gold rush town. Hill End
is a small old gold mining town with a population of just over 100 people. The
gold may be harder to find but the charm of an old town lives on in Hill End.
The National Parks and wildlife service have preserved the charm of this town.
Take your time slow down and picture what life would have been like during the
gold rush. Imagine a population of 8,000 people. The sound of huge Stamper
Batteries working 24 hours a day in the continual search for gold. The sound
was so great that when they broke down people had trouble sleeping because it
was too quiet. Imagine a mile of shops and 27 pubs.
